Public Member Functions | |
String | getIscpResponse (String prefix) |
boolean | isConnected () |
OnkyoEiscp (String host, int port) | |
String | sendCommand (String command) |
String | sendCommand (String command, String args) |
Private Member Functions | |
String | getCommandPrefix (String command) |
void | initialize () |
Private Attributes | |
EiscpConnector | eiscpConnector |
final String | host |
Map< String, String > | iscpResult |
EiscpListener | messageListener |
final int | port |
Definition at line 29 of file OnkyoEiscp.java.
org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.OnkyoEiscp | ( | String | host, |
int | port | ||
) | [inline] |
Definition at line 45 of file OnkyoEiscp.java.
String org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.getCommandPrefix | ( | String | command | ) | [inline, private] |
Definition at line 91 of file OnkyoEiscp.java.
String org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.getIscpResponse | ( | String | prefix | ) | [inline] |
Definition at line 64 of file OnkyoEiscp.java.
void org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.initialize | ( | ) | [inline, private] |
Definition at line 54 of file OnkyoEiscp.java.
boolean org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.isConnected | ( | ) | [inline] |
Definition at line 143 of file OnkyoEiscp.java.
String org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.sendCommand | ( | String | command | ) | [inline] |
Definition at line 101 of file OnkyoEiscp.java.
String org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.sendCommand | ( | String | command, |
String | args | ||
) | [inline] |
Definition at line 105 of file OnkyoEiscp.java.
EiscpConnector org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.eiscpConnector [private] |
Definition at line 33 of file OnkyoEiscp.java.
final String org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.host [private] |
Definition at line 31 of file OnkyoEiscp.java.
Map<String, String> org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.iscpResult [private] |
Definition at line 34 of file OnkyoEiscp.java.
EiscpListener org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.messageListener [private] |
new EiscpListener() { @Override public void receivedIscpMessage(String message) { iscpResult.put(message.substring(0, 3), message); } }
Definition at line 36 of file OnkyoEiscp.java.
final int org.rosmultimedia.player.onkyo.eiscp.OnkyoEiscp.port [private] |
Definition at line 32 of file OnkyoEiscp.java.